## Break-Glass: Monthly Partition Maintenance (Ordwell DB)

Heads up, reviewer: the ledger tables are partitioned by month, and the partition-creation job occasionally misses a rollover. Break-glass access lets on-call create the next month's partition manually. It's logged, audited, and expires in one hour. To unseal the admin role, enter the recovery passphrase shown here:

strongbox words: prawyn-fenmir

## Further reading

The occupancy feed for the Corvane garages publishes counts every 15 seconds per level. Counts come from the Stilehurst gate controllers and are eventually consistent; expect brief negative deltas during shift changes when attendants override gates manually. Downstream consumers should treat per-level totals as advisory and reconcile against the hourly snapshot. Schema details, retention policy, and the override event taxonomy are not duplicated here. For the full feed specification, see the internal page below.

wiki page, tahaf-tajog: https://jira.ordindyn.corp/pipeline

## Break-Glass: Health Checks Behind the Fennelgate LB

Welcome aboard! Quick heads-up: if the Fennelgate load balancer starts marking every pod in the Quillhaven cluster unhealthy, don't panic. Usually it's the /pulse endpoint timing out, not an actual outage. First, check the probe interval config; someone always fat-fingers it. If you truly can't reach the admin console and traffic is bleeding, you're allowed to use break-glass access to bypass the health gate. To unlock the emergency console, enter the recovery passphrase below.

strongbox words: fraath-isteth